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Olá galera.
Eu procurei no google e aqui no forum uma função no mysql que seria equivalente a pg_query_params do Postgresql, mas não obtive sucesso na pesquisa. No mysql apenas achei a função mysql_query, mas está não suporta parametros. Abaixo estou pondo o exemplo.
public function getById($codigo){
$user = null;
$this->sql = "SELECT * FROM usuario " .
"WHERE usu_codigo = $1";
$params[0] = $codigo;
$rs = mysql_query_params($this->con, $this->sql, $params);
if (!$rs)
throw new Exception();
else
if ($row = mysql_fetch_assoc($rs)){
$user = new User();
$user->codigo = $codigo;
$user->login = $row['usu_login'];
}
mysql_free_result($rs);
return ($user);
}
Como podem ver eu botei mysql_query_params onde teria o pg_query_params, o mysql_query_params vi em alguns foruns mas me retorna este erro ao tentar executar ( Call to undefined function mysql_query_params() ). Desde já obrigado!Carregando comentários...